bgccsownsck Posted June 4, 2018 Author #30 Share Posted June 4, 2018 For dinner tonight we ate in Moderno. This was one of our favorites when we sailed Hawaii! It did not disappoint. The seafood chowder on the salad bar was one of the stand outside for me. When they brought out the sirloin, I got the first perfectly cooked crust cut. 🤤 All the meats were cooked beautifully. None were too dry or over seasoned. The chicken legs had a wonderfully crusty skin but still managed to be juicy in the middle. Grilled pineapple was a star as well, making for a great dessert. I had my first ever mojito. It was a raspberry guava and was amazing! I also had an always delicious chocolate martini. bgccsownsck Posted June 5, 2018 Author #41 Share Posted June 5, 2018 So... Cagney's. Before I start my review let me just say this: we went to Cagney's on New year's Eve aboard Pride of America. It was pretty much the worst experience ever. We waited at the bar 2 1/2 hours longer than our reservation time. My steak was overcooked and Sean's was undercooked. This trip to Cagney's could not have been more different. Both of our steaks were cooked beautifully. All the food was amazing. Stand outs for me were the Mac and Cheese, the Brownie and of course the Filet Mignon. I'm also including tonight's MDR menu even though we didn't eat there. bgccsownsck Posted June 6, 2018 Author #45 Share Posted June 6, 2018 This morning we had breakfast very early in Garden Cafe. The early risers menu consists of fresh fruit, cereal and milk, assorted pastries and juices. After showers we had second breakfast at O'Sheehan's. I forgot a menu picture [emoji19] After more getting ready and a glass of wine from my Mother (to stop me pacing around the stateroom) it was time for the dress. We attended the port shopping talk yesterday afternoon and through Linda (who gave the talk) we got signed up for a priority tender. Because of the Bliss being in Port, the ship didn't actually get to dock until around 3. At 1 they started tendering for people who wanted to get off before that. A quick cab up to pick up our marriage license, an Uber back, and some shopping later we were meeting family at the tramway for the wedding. The ride up to Mt. Roberts was painless and beautiful. The hike up was a little taxing, but we all made it. Our officiant was from Alaska Weddings and did a good job with our ceremony. The shuttle back to the ship was right there by the tram. Easy to find. Now we are back on board for dinner in La Cucina. Wedding photos!!! Sent from my Pixel XL using Forums mobile app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

bgccsownsck Posted June 7, 2018 Author #49 Share Posted June 7, 2018 After a quick breakfast we got a bus for our first excursion. We chose the Yukon Territory Scenic Drive, mostly because I wanted to see emerald lake. We were on a little bus that seated 29 passengers. There were only 27 of us. Sitting on the right side of the bus was a good idea. We got tired on the way back and I closed my eyes involuntarily for about 20 minutes on the way back. We saw Lake Tutshi, Carcross, the Carcross Dessert, Emerald Lake, and many other places along the highway whose names escape me. We even saw a black bear on our way back. Lunch was 3 types of sandwiches, two types of soup, fresh fruit, banana bread, and apple pie.
